Investigation Underway After Claims of Drone Targeting Israeli Embassy in London

The Metropolitan Police are investigating a security incident near the Israeli embassy in London following claims that drones were used to target the building.

Context

The police have confirmed that the embassy itself was not attacked, but they are assessing discarded items found in a nearby park. S1S2

Key points
  • The Metropolitan Police cordoned off Kensington Gardens for the investigation. S1
  • Counter Terrorism Policing London is involved in the investigation. S2
  • A group claimed responsibility for the drone targeting in a video shared online. S2
  • No dangerous substances have been confirmed as part of the incident. S1
  • The police are assessing the nature of the discarded items found. S2
  • The incident has raised security concerns around the embassy. S1
  • Authorities are working to determine the intentions behind the drone claims. S2
  • The investigation is ongoing as police gather more information. S1S2
